#2ebbce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2ebbce is composed of 18% red, 73.3% green and 80.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 77.7% cyan, 9.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 19.2% black. It has a hue angle of 187.1 degrees, a saturation of 63.5% and a lightness of 49.4%. #2ebbce color hex could be obtained by blending #5cffff with #00779d. Closest websafe color is: #33cccc.

#2ebbce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2ebbce has RGB values of R:46, G:187, B:206 and CMYK values of C:0.78, M:0.09, Y:0,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 3062734.
